Are Arrest Records Public in Marion County, Iowa?

Arrest records in Marion County, Iowa are public documents pursuant to Iowa Code Chapter 22, commonly known as the Iowa Public Records Law. This statute establishes that government records, including those pertaining to arrests, shall be accessible to the public unless specifically exempted by law. The Iowa Public Records Law operates under the principle that government transparency is essential for maintaining public trust and accountability in the criminal justice system.

Members of the public may access arrest records maintained by the Marion County Sheriff's Office and other law enforcement agencies operating within the county's jurisdiction. These records typically document instances where individuals have been taken into custody by law enforcement officials on suspicion of criminal activity. The public nature of these records serves several important functions:

  • Promotes transparency in law enforcement operations
  • Enables citizens to monitor the activities of government agencies
  • Provides information that may be relevant to public safety concerns
  • Supports journalistic reporting on matters of public interest

It should be noted that certain information within arrest records may be redacted or withheld in accordance with privacy protections established under Iowa Code § 22.7, which enumerates specific categories of confidential records.

Can Arrest Records be Found Online in Marion County?

Marion County arrest records are available through various online platforms maintained by county and state agencies. The Marion County Sheriff's Office provides digital access to current inmate information through their "Who's in Jail" database. This resource allows members of the public to view basic information about individuals currently detained in the Marion County Jail.

The online availability of arrest records is governed by Iowa Code § 22.3A, which addresses the electronic accessibility of public records. Pursuant to this statute, government bodies are permitted to provide public access to records in electronic format, though certain limitations may apply regarding the manner and extent of such access.

Online access to Marion County arrest records offers several advantages:

  • Provides 24-hour accessibility without requiring in-person visits to government offices
  • Reduces administrative burden on county staff
  • Enables efficient searching and retrieval of specific records
  • Facilitates remote access for individuals unable to visit county offices during business hours

Users should be aware that online records may not always contain complete information, and certain details may be omitted in accordance with privacy laws and administrative policies.

Contents of a Marion County Arrest Record

Marion County arrest records typically contain standardized information documenting the circumstances and details of an individual's arrest. These records serve as official documentation of law enforcement actions and typically include the following elements:

Biographical Information

  • Full legal name of the arrested individual
  • Date of birth
  • Physical description (height, weight, identifying features)
  • Residential address
  • Booking photograph ("mugshot")

Arrest Details

  • Date and time of arrest
  • Location where the arrest occurred
  • Name and badge number of the arresting officer(s)
  • Law enforcement agency responsible for the arrest
  • Statutory authority under which the arrest was made

Criminal Charges

  • Specific charges filed against the individual
  • Iowa Code sections allegedly violated
  • Classification of offenses (felony, aggravated misdemeanor, serious misdemeanor, or simple misdemeanor)
  • Case number assigned by the court

Procedural Information

  • Booking date and time
  • Bond amount and type (if applicable)
  • Court appearance dates
  • Detention status (released or in custody)

Additional Documentation

  • Incident reports related to the arrest
  • Property and evidence inventory
  • Rights advisement acknowledgment

The content and format of arrest records are maintained in accordance with Iowa Administrative Code 661-82, which establishes standards for law enforcement records management.

Expungement of Arrest Records in Marion County

Under certain circumstances, individuals may petition for the expungement of arrest records in Marion County pursuant to Iowa Code Chapter 901C. Expungement is the legal process through which arrest records are removed from public access, though they may remain accessible to law enforcement agencies for official purposes.

Iowa law provides several pathways for expungement, each with specific eligibility criteria:

Dismissals and Acquittals Iowa Code § 901C.2 permits expungement when:

  • The criminal charge was dismissed with prejudice
  • The defendant was acquitted (found not guilty)
  • The defendant was not prosecuted due to a deferred judgment

Waiting Period Requirements For cases involving dismissals or acquittals, a mandatory waiting period of 180 days from the date of the dismissal or acquittal must elapse before filing for expungement.

Alcohol-Related Offenses Iowa Code § 123.46(6) provides specific expungement provisions for certain public intoxication offenses.

Marijuana Possession First-offense marijuana possession convictions may be eligible for expungement under Iowa Code § 124.401(5).

The expungement process requires filing a petition with the Marion County District Court:
